Who are we?
We are a leading set of barristers based in the heart of Birmingham. We provide advice and advocacy in a wide range of areas, although crime is our core area of practice.
As a specialist set, we have a large and experienced criminal team. We act in matters dealt with in the magistrates’ courts to the most serious, complex and high-profile cases.
Whilst we cover a wide range of work, we recognize that, from the perspective of the client, your case is the most important one. We consequently see nothing as routine or minor.
